Pastor Aloysius Bujjingo of House of Prayer Ministries International (HPMI) and Suzan Makula Nantaba have finally appeared before Entebbe Magistrate’s Court on Friday, January 21, 2022.
Bujjingo and Makula face charges of bigamy and accusations of contracting marriage by customary law when already married under the Marriage Act.
Today they were formally charged before Entebbe Magistrates court.
Appearing before Grade One Magistrate Stella Okwang, Bujjingo and Makula denied the charges.
Their accuser, private prosecutor Hassan Male Mabirizi, has asked court to deny Bujjingo bail. (Read story here).
